PGR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2018 in Review

762 of the 4,374 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Progressive (PGR) for Q3 2018, worth a combined $33.7B — up 21% from $27.9B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 81 funds opened new PGR positions and 66 closed out — a net gain of 15 holders — while 263 added to existing stakes and 293 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Wellington Management Group, adding an estimated $242M. The largest seller was T. Rowe Price Associates, cutting an estimated $428M.
